                                                                  H.B. No. 2650




AN ACT
relating to local government participation in the financing of turnpike projects. B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: SECTION 1. Subchapter I, Chapter 361, Transportation Code, is amended by adding Section 361.308 to read as follows: Sec. 361.308. AGREEMENTS WITH LOCAL GOVERNMENTS. (a) In this section, "local government" means a: (1) county, municipality, special district, or other political subdivision of this state; (2) local government corporation created under Subchapter D, Chapter 431; or (3) combination of two or more entities described by Subdivision (1) or (2). (b) A local government may enter into an agreement with the department or a private entity under which the local government assists in the financing of the construction, maintenance, and operation of a turnpike project located in the government's jurisdiction in return for a percentage of the revenue from the project. (c) A local government may use any revenue available for road purposes, including bond and tax proceeds, to provide financing under Subsection (b). (d) An agreement under this section between a local government and a private entity must be approved by the department. (e) Revenue received by a local government under an agreement under this section must be used for transportation purposes. SECTION 2. Subchapter G, Chapter 370, Transportation Code, is amended by adding Section 370.317 to read as follows: Sec. 370.317. AGREEMENTS WITH LOCAL GOVERNMENTS. (a) In this section, "local government" means a: (1) county, municipality, special district, or other political subdivision of this state; (2) local government corporation created under Subchapter D, Chapter 431; or (3) combination of two or more entities described by Subdivision (1) or (2). (b) A local government may enter into an agreement with an authority or a private entity under which the local government assists in the financing of the construction, maintenance, and operation of a turnpike project located in the government's jurisdiction in return for a percentage of the revenue from the project. (c) A local government may use any revenue available for road purposes, including bond and tax proceeds, to provide financing under Subsection (b). (d) An agreement under this section between a local government and a private entity must be approved by the department. (e) Revenue received by a local government under an agreement under this section must be used for transportation purposes. SECTION 3. This Act takes effect September 1, 2005. ______________________________ ______________________________ President of the Senate Speaker of the House I certify that H.B.
